In ​ (a)   reproduction, an organism will inherit its genetic information from two different parents. This helps increase genetic ​ (b)   . In ​ (c)   reproduction, an organism will inherit its genetic ​ (d)   from one parent. The new offspring will have the same genetic information as its parent.

sexual
variation
asexual
information
